As rare as it is, ameloblastoma can damage a person’s face. It can damage the tissues surrounding the area where it developed, causing deformity in a person’s jawbone. It is a disorder where a tumor forms in a person’s mouth, usually located where the third molar or wisdom tooth sprouts. It is also referred to as adamantinoma or odontogenic tumor. Although it has many treatments, most experts suggest amputation as the best treatment method for ameloblasts. Besides the portion of the face where it spawned, the tumor can also damage the sinuses and tissues near eye sockets. Having said this, one’s vision can even be affected if the condition is not addressed immediately. There are many symptoms to this particular defect. One can suffer from swelling, pain or numbness, and even difficulty of moving his or her jaw. It may seem obvious, but most people complain about their dentures and bridges being unfit all of a sudden when ameloblastoma develops, so this can be counted as a symptom as well.
